摘要: 好像网上没人....和我推出....同一个式子啊..... 阅读全文
posted @ 2018-12-05 14:44 Kananix 阅读(310) 评论(0) 推荐(0) 编辑
摘要: 我博弈基础好差.. 阅读全文
posted @ 2018-12-05 09:21 Kananix 阅读(194) 评论(0) 推荐(0) 编辑
摘要: 很好的锻炼推柿子能力的题目 LOJ #2026 题意 有$n$个人$ m$门学科,第$ i$门的分数为不大于$U_i$的一个正整数 定义A「打爆」B当且仅当A的每门学科的分数都不低于B的该门学科的分数 已知第一个人第$ i$们学科的排名为$ R_i$, 即这门学科不低于$ n-R_i$人的分数,但一 阅读全文
posted @ 2018-12-05 07:54 Kananix 阅读(335) 评论(0) 推荐(0) 编辑
摘要: 用$ Min-Max$容斥之后要推的东西少了好多 无耻的用实数快读抢了BZOJ、Luogu、LOJ三个$ OJ$的Rank 1 即将update:被STO TXC OTZ超了QAQ 题意:集合$ [0,2^n)$中每次以一定给出概率产生一个数,求产生数按位或值为$ 2^n-1$的数字数量期望 $ S 阅读全文
posted @ 2018-12-04 14:54 Kananix 阅读(187) 评论(0) 推荐(0) 编辑
摘要: 以前开过一遍这题,以为很难没刚下去 今天$ review$一遍分析了一下感觉也还好 luogu 4859 题意:给定长度为$ n \leq 2000$的数组$ A,B$求完全匹配使得$A>B$的对数比$A<B$的对数恰好多$k$组的方案数 $ Solution:$ 直接$DP $是$ n^3$的 考 阅读全文
posted @ 2018-12-04 10:28 Kananix 阅读(294) 评论(2) 推荐(0) 编辑
摘要: 这怎么想得到啊......... UOJ #36 题意:求随机一个集合的子集的异或和的$k$次方的期望值,保证答案$ \lt 2^{63},1 \leq k \leq 5$ $ Solution:$ 首先考虑$ k=1$的时候怎么做:如果某位上有$ 1$则有$ \frac{1}{2}$的概率可以取到 阅读全文
posted @ 2018-12-04 08:27 Kananix 阅读(257) 评论(0) 推荐(0) 编辑
摘要: 为什么你们常数都这么小啊 UOJ #276 题意:在树上找一条链使得|边权平均值$ -k$|尽量小,$ n<=5e4$ $ Solution:$ 首先二分答案$ ans$,即我们需要找一条链使得边权平均值 $\in [-ans,ans]$ 我们分正负两半分开讨论 先假设平均值$ \in (0,ans 阅读全文
posted @ 2018-12-03 17:11 Kananix 阅读(220) 评论(0) 推荐(0) 编辑
摘要: 生成函数和组合数学的灵活应用 LOJ #6261 题意:求一个数列的$ k$次前缀和 $ Solution:$ 我们对原数列$ a$建生成函数$ A=\sum\limits_{i=0}^{n-1} a_ix^i $ 求一次前缀和相当于将$ A$卷上生成函数$ B=\sum\limits_{i=0}^ 阅读全文
posted @ 2018-12-03 09:33 Kananix 阅读(217) 评论(0) 推荐(0) 编辑
摘要: 不错的推柿子题 LOJ #2058 题意:求$\sum\limits_{i=0}^n\sum\limits_{j=0}^nS(i,j)·2^j·j!$其中$ S(n,m)$是第二类斯特林数 $ Solution:$ 首先考虑第二类斯特林数的意义:将$ n$个有标号元素放入$ m$个无标号集合(无空集 阅读全文
posted @ 2018-12-02 20:10 Kananix 阅读(280) 评论(0) 推荐(0) 编辑
摘要: 还是见的题太少了 「NowCoder Contest 295」H. Playing games 题意:选出尽量多的数使得异或和为$ 0$ $ Solution:$ 问题等价于选出尽量少的数使得异或和为全集 根据线性基思想可以推得整个集合的异或集合可以被不超过$ bitcount$个数的异或集合表示 阅读全文
posted @ 2018-12-01 12:42 Kananix 阅读(189) 评论(0) 推荐(0) 编辑
摘要: 这样$ PKUWC$就只差一道斗地主了 假装补题补完了吧..... 这题还是挺巧妙的啊...... LOJ # 2541 题意 每个人有一个嘲讽值$a_i$,每次杀死一个人,杀死某人的概率为$ \frac{a_i}{a_{alive}}$,求第一个人最后死的概率 数据范围:$ 1 \leq a_i 阅读全文
posted @ 2018-11-30 11:42 Kananix 阅读(348) 评论(0) 推荐(0) 编辑
摘要: $ Min$-$Max$容斥真好用 $ PKUWC$滚粗后这题一直在$ todolist$里 今天才补掉..还要更加努力啊.. LOJ #2542 题意:给一棵不超过$ 18$个节点的树,$ 5000$次询问,每次问从根随机游走走遍一个集合的期望步数 $ Solution:$ 考虑$ Min$-$M 阅读全文
posted @ 2018-11-29 18:34 Kananix 阅读(497) 评论(6) 推荐(0) 编辑
摘要: 听说这是一道$ Tourist$现场没出的题 Codeforces #662C 题意: 给定$n*m的 01$矩阵,可以任意反转一行/列($0$变$1$,$1$变$0$),求最少$ 1$的数量 $ n<=20 \ m<=100000$ $ Solution$ 考虑暴力 枚举每一行反转/不反转 预处理 阅读全文
posted @ 2018-11-29 14:49 Kananix 阅读(170) 评论(0) 推荐(0) 编辑
摘要: 有好多好玩的知识点 LOJ 题意:在集合中选$ n$个元素(可重复选)使得乘积模$ m$为$ x$,求方案数对$ 1004535809$取模 $ n<=10^9,m<=8000且是质数,集合大小不超过m$ $ Solution:$ 我们先考虑改乘积为加和之后怎么做 直接对于集合中的数构建生成函数 所 阅读全文
posted @ 2018-11-29 07:45 Kananix 阅读(170) 评论(0) 推荐(0) 编辑
摘要: 是不是$ vector$存图非常慢啊...... 题意:求数对$(x,y,z)$的数量使得存在一条$x$到$z$的路径上经过$y$,要求$x,y,z$两两不同 LOJ #2587 $ Solution:$ 首先考虑一棵树的情况怎么做 我们枚举每一个点计算贡献,贡献即为经过这个点的链的数量 只要求出这 阅读全文
posted @ 2018-11-26 15:02 Kananix 阅读(183) 评论(0) 推荐(0) 编辑

Contact with me